IIRC, the bag in the center locker has two ports and both are used: the lower for fill, the upper for overflow/vent. They used Fly High/Flow-Rite fittings like these from wakemakers
Seems unnecessary... I would tee off of the overflow/vent since it is already right behind the helm.
I think you would want to add a fitting to the front of the center floor sac so it doesn't fill with air. My 2008 had a plug at the front of the bag. I added a fitting and and tee'd from that to both sides of the ibs legs by drilling a hole in the floor on both sides. Used a couple 90" couplers for the tight bends.
